Original Description
Frank Paton's Anatroccoli In Uno Stagno (Ducks in a Pond) is a charming Victorian-era animalier painting that captures an idyllic moment of rural tranquility. Created in the late 19th century, the work exemplifies Paton's signature style—meticulous naturalism blended with gentle anthropomorphism, where wildlife is rendered with anatomical precision yet imbued with subtle narrative charm. The composition centers on a family of ducks gliding across a sun-dappled pond, surrounded by lush vegetation that Paton renders with delicate brushwork, creating a harmonious balance between detail and atmosphere. As a lesser-known yet skilled British animal painter, Paton occupies an intriguing niche in art history, bridging the technical rigor of Landseer and the sentimental appeal of popular Victorian genre scenes. The painting's subdued earthy palette and soft luminosity reflect the era's fascination with pastoral nostalgia, offering a window into pre-industrial England's idealized countryside.
